The massive 7.0 scale earthquake hit Haiti one week ago, on January 12. The world response continues to overwhelm with aid from all corners of the world reaching the people of Haiti in their efforts to recover.

The online gambling industry too is reaching out. Bodog founder Calvin Ayre has called out for the industry to help with the relief effort on his blog.

Ayre himself has sent GBP 10,000 to UK based Oxfam, according to his blog announcement. He added that his foundation will match online gambling's donations up to $1,000,000.

"I think the global online gaming community has a duty to do something," Ayre said.

Like the example he set himself, Ayre calls out to industry members saying: "Everyone making money has a duty to help."
